Join us for a night of stories and essays from Bailey Gaylin Moore & Donald Quist, our double-header event in Waldorf University's long-running Distinguished Visiting Writers series! This event is FREE and open to the public.
Bailey Gaylin Moore is the author of Thank You for Staying with Me, an IPPY Gold and International book awards winner. She has been featured in Poets & Writers, Oxford America, the Writer’s Chronicle, AGNI, Brevity, Pleiades, and other journals. She serves as the Editor-in-Chief of PAST TEN and edited The Past Ten: an Anthology, which has writers reflect on where they were ten years ago.
Donald Quist is author of two essay collections, Harbors, a Foreword INDIES Bronze Winner and International Book Awards Finalist, and To Those Bounded. He has a linked story collection, For Other Ghosts. His writing has appeared in AGNI, North American Review, Michigan Quarterly Review, Poets & Writers, The Rumpus, and was Notable in Best American Essays. He is creator of the online nonfiction series PAST TEN. Quist has received fellowships from Sundress Academy for the Arts, Virginia Center for the Creative Arts, and Kimbilio Fiction. He is Assistant Professor of Creative Writing at University of Missouri.
